Verification — three different counts, do not merge them
5 required status contexts are what GitHub enforces on master. Proven with
gh api repos/antropos17/Aegis/branches/master/protection --jq '.required_status_checks'
→ contexts [build, lint, svelte-check, test, audit], strict: true (branch must be up to
date before merge). No rulesets add more: /rulesets and /rules/branches/master return [].
A context is a JOB, not a command — lint and svelte-check run two commands each.
10 verification commands live inside those 5 jobs (.github/workflows/ci.yml):
| required context | commands the job runs, after npm ci |
|---|---|
| build | npm run build:renderer |
| lint | npm run format:check, then npm run lint |
| svelte-check | npm run typecheck, then npm run typecheck:svelte |
| test | npm run test:coverage, npm run verify:gate, npm run verify:seq-gate, then npm run counts:check |
| audit | npm audit --audit-level=high --omit=dev |
format:check is a STEP of lint, and verify:gate, verify:seq-gate and counts:check are
STEPS of test — none is a job, and none is a context of its own.
